解决方法:选择性能较高的服务器型号,如具有更高主频的处理器、更大的内存容量、更快的硬盘读写速度等,可以考虑对服务器进行负载均衡,将流量分散到多台服务器上,提高整体服务器的处理能力。
解决方法:对数据库进行优化,包括建立合理的索引、优化SQL语句、调整数据库参数等,可以考虑使用缓存技术,将热点数据缓存在内存中,减少对数据库的访问次数。
解决方法:对网站代码进行重构,消除冗余代码,简化逻辑结构,提高代码执行效率,可以使用性能分析工具对代码进行性能分析,找出性能瓶颈并进行针对性优化。
解决方法:检查网络设备和线路是否存在故障,确保网络连接稳定可靠,对于网络带宽不足的问题,可以考虑升级网络设备或者与网络服务提供商协商增加带宽。
2、如何监控服务器运行状态?
答:可以使用各种监控工具来实时监控服务器的运行状态,如CPU使用率、内存使用率、磁盘I/O、网络流量等,这些数据可以帮助我们及时发现服务器异常,并采取相应措施解决问题,常见的监控工具有Zabbix、Nagios、Cacti等。
3、如何优化服务器性能?
答:可以从以下几个方面入手优化服务器性能:提高硬件配置、优化数据库查询、优化代码执行效率、采用缓存技术等,还可以采用负载均衡技术将流量分散到多台服务器上,提高整体服务器的处理能力。
THE END